This table ranks reproducible PINK1-AS RNA expression–survival associations across cancer types. High PINK1-AS expression shows unfavorable associations in BLCA, KICH, LGG and ACC, but favorable associations in KIRC and COAD. The BLCA Kaplan–Meier curve shows clear separation, with the high-expression group declining faster, consistent with the unfavorable association (log-rank p < 0.001). Together, the overview and detailed table identify BLCA as the clearest survival context for PINK1-AS RNA expression.

This table ranks reproducible tumor–normal expression differences for PINK1-AS. A negative fold-change indicates higher expression in normal tissue than in tumor tissue. PINK1-AS shows lower tumor expression in THCA and KICH and higher tumor expression in KIRC, HNSC, STAD and LIHC. The KIRC box plot shows higher PINK1-AS RNA expression in tumor versus normal tissue (log2 FC = +0.550, t-test p < 0.001).
